The author performed an objective audiometry, forming a conditioned reflex of pupilla to light stimulation in rabbit as fundamental experiment before making an experiment on the DHSM-deafness. The result was acquired as follows: miosis as positive conditioned reflex was rather difficult to get, while mydriasis as negative conditioned reflex to white noise was easily perceived and lasted for a quite long time.
Having reference to the fact that conditioned reflex can be formed sooner when the pure tone of conditioned reflex is so faint as auditory threshold, it is conceivable that the inhibition appeared in this experiment has relation to the mydriasis provoking as non-conditioned reflex which has been recognized as acoustic pupillary reflex by intense sound stimulation. From these facts, the author concluded that it is unsuitable to apply an objective audiometry of rabbit for experimental studies of the long duration.
By use of an objective audiometry of conditioned animals, the author observed the hearing impairment caused by the use of dihydrostreptomycin. The author classified the conditioned dogs into several groups and observed the change of hearing acuity: the group for which DHSM was applied and the group for which vitamin B
1 in combination with dihydrostreptomycin.
1) DHSM was used 50mg/kg a day and 200mg/kg a day for the first group and third group, respectively. Comparing with the first group, 4 times dosage was applied for the 3rd group; but it did not cause severe hearing impairment in early stage. Approximately 10g for the first group and 20g for the 3rd group, in other words, about 10-20g total usage caused the hearing impairment. There was a range in the total use of the medicament to bring out the appearance of hearing impairment. Among 7 conditioned dogs, severe hearing disorder was observed in one, medium in 3 and slight in 2. One dog didn't show any hard of hearing at all.
2) DHSM 50 mg/kg vitamin B1 2 mg/kg a day and DHSM 200 mg/kg vitamin B1 10 mg/kg a day was applied for the 2nd group and the 4th group, respectively. No difference could be observed between these two groups. In the comparing audiograms before and after the use of dihydrostreptomycin, only 0-10 db change in all frequency area was perceived and the hearing disorder did not appear at all.
3) In the first part, observation for long term was made on the clinical cases before, during and after the simultaneous application of DHSM and vitamin B
1.
Summarizing the result in the first part and experiments on animals in this part, the author concluded that hearing impairment caused by DHSM can be prevented by the combined use of vitamin B1 at the time of DHSM application.
